Breaking Down Solar Jargon
Let's cut through the technobabble. At its core, a solar setup involves three key components:
- Panels converting sunlight to DC current
- Inverters transforming DC to usable AC power
- Battery storage systems for nighttime use
Wait, no—that's not entirely complete. Actually, modern systems often include smart energy managers too. Germany's Fraunhofer Institute recently showed how combining battery storage with AI-driven load balancing can boost efficiency by 40% compared to traditional setups.
Global Market Pulse: China's Dominance
While California gets the media spotlight, China's been quietly building a solar empire. They now manufacture 80% of the world's photovoltaic components. But here's the kicker: Chinese households are installing residential systems at half the cost of their US counterparts. How? Massive government subsidies and vertically integrated supply chains.
A Shanghai factory worker powers their EV using rooftop panels while their American counterpart pays $0.23/kWh for grid electricity. This disparity explains why Asia-Pacific now leads in distributed solar adoption, with India and Vietnam showing 200% year-on-year growth.
From Textbook to Rooftop: Bavaria's Success Story
The Bavarian village of Wildpoldsried generates 500% more energy than it needs through community solar projects. Their secret sauce?
"We treated every roof as a potential power plant," says Mayor Arno Zengerle. "Even our cow sheds got panels!"
This grassroots approach proves that renewable energy systems work best when tailored to local contexts. They've essentially created a solar-powered circular economy—excess energy fuels a biogas plant that fertilizes crops feeding dairy cows.
Quick Solar Questions Answered
Q: How long do solar panels really last?
A: Most manufacturers guarantee 80% efficiency after 25 years—though many systems outlive their warranties.
Q: Can I go completely off-grid?
A: Technically yes, but hybrid systems with grid backup are more practical for most households.
Q: What's the payback period?
A: In sunny regions like Spain or Arizona: 6-8 years. Cloudier areas might take 10-12 years.
Here's something you might not have considered: Solar installations actually increase property values. A 2023 Zillow study found US homes with PV systems sell 4.1% faster than equivalent properties. Not bad for a "green premium," right?
The Maintenance Myth Busted
Contrary to popular belief, solar arrays aren't high-maintenance divas. Apart from occasional cleaning and inverter checks, they're pretty much "install and forget" systems. In fact, the biggest maintenance cost for most homeowners is replacing batteries every 10-15 years.
But wait—what about hail storms? Actually, modern panels can withstand 1-inch hailstones at 50mph. Tesla's solar roof tiles even come with a lifetime weather warranty. Talk about confidence in your product!
